Abstract

A method of representing an object appearing in an image, the method comprising deriving a plurality of view descriptors of the object, each view descriptor corresponding to a different view of the object, and associating the two or more view descriptors, the method comprising indicating for each view descriptor when the respective view corresponds to a view of the object appearing in the image.
